What I Check Before Buying
I always read the label first. I look at the ingredients, the type of sweetener used, and whether it is suitable for my needs. Some yellow packet sweeteners use different sweetening agents, so I make sure I understand what I’m buying. I also check the serving size because I want to know how much sweetness I’m getting per packet.
Taste and Aftertaste Matter to Me
In my experience, taste is the most important part. Some artificial sweeteners taste very close to sugar, while others have a strong aftertaste. I prefer one that blends naturally into my drink and doesn’t overpower the flavor. If I’m buying a new brand, I usually test a small pack first before committing to a larger box.
How I Compare Price and Value
I don’t just look at the price of the box. I compare how many packets I get and how much sweetness each packet provides. Sometimes a slightly more expensive product gives me better value because I need fewer packets or enjoy the taste more. For me, value means quality, convenience, and how often I’ll use it.
Packaging and Convenience
I like yellow packet artificial sweeteners that are easy to carry and store. Individual packets are helpful when I travel, eat out, or keep them in my bag. I also prefer packaging that stays fresh and is easy to open without making a mess. If the box is sturdy and the packets are sealed well, that is a plus for me.
